Delilah CULLISON was born abt. 1773 in Baltimore, Crown Colony of Maryland

Delilah CULLISON was the child of Jesse CULLISON   and   Elizabeth CHAPMAN

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):

Delilah  married  James MALONEE 13 February 1795 in Baltimore, Maryland, USA .  The couple had (at least) 1 child.
James MALONEE  was born abt. 1770 in Maryland, USA.  James died abt. 1837 in Bedford, Pennsylvania, USA.  James was the child of John MALONEE (MALONE) and Sarah HART?.

Delilah CULLISON died 2 September 1860 in Indiana, USA.

NewsThe War of 1812 was a conflict between the United States and Great Britain, lasting from 1812 to 1815. It was primarily fueled by issues such as trade restrictions due to Britain's ongoing war with France, impressment of American sailors into the British Navy, and British support of Native American tribes against American expansion. The war ended with the Treaty of Ghent, restoring pre-war boundaries but resolving few of the initial disputes.
